public async Task DeletarAsync(Guid id) { var fornecedor = await _fornecedorRepository.GetByIdAsync(id); ValidarSeFornecedorExiste(fornecedor); await ValidarSeExistemProdutosVinculados(id); if (Notification.HasErrorNotifications()) { return; } await _fornecedorRepository.DeleteAsync(fornecedor); }
public async Task <ActionResult> Delete([FromBody] fornecedor model) { await ifornecedor.DeleteAsync(model); return(Ok()); }
public async Task <bool> Remover(Guid id) { await _fornecedorRepository.DeleteAsync(id); return(true); }